Item Description

Olivenite and turquoise are very rare from the famous and ancient mines at Horni Slavkov and are exceptionally rare in combination, such as this very fine and showy piece from the Herb Obodda dealer stock. A dense cluster of gemmy, glass-green, olivenite needles lines a vug and partially engulfs the side of a 1.2 cm terminated quartz crystal. Nearbly are classic blue turquoise crystals and crusts, more olivenite needles and botryoidal malachite and sky-blue chrysocolla. The 3-dimensional matrix is oxide-coated quartz. Old-time, very rare combination material and comes with a faded Schortmanns label, probably dating prior to World War II.
